Request for Advice: Routing Recorded Audio for Clean On-Air Playback with AetherSDR
I am using AetherSDR and looking to record on-air signals, clean up the audio quality, and route the playback back through my transmitter to re-broadcast. I would appreciate ideas, software recommendations, or configuration tips from anyone who has set up a similar audio routing workflow.
Current Goal
Record: Capture clean, clear audio of on-air stations using AetherSDR.
Process: Apply processing (e.g., noise reduction, equalization, or audio leveling) to refine the audio quality.
Re-transmit: Route the processed playback directly into the transmit audio input of AetherSDR/radio setup for clean re-transmission.
